About The Position

The Crisis Center of Tampa Bay brings help, hope and healing to people facing serious life challenges or trauma resulting from sexual assault or abuse, domestic violence, financial distress, substance abuse, medical emergency, suicidal thoughts, emotional or situational problems. The MST Program Manager is responsible for clinical and administrative supervision of the MST Program including assuring availability of clinical and administrative support to therapists 24 hours/day, 7 days/week. In addition, establish measurable goals & objectives and identify best practices and effective strategies to meet MST and funder performance expectations. The MST Program Manager reports to the Clinical Director, and in their absence, the Director of S4KF. Requirements

  • Master’s Degree in behavioral health or related field required
  • Licensed required (LMHC, LCSW or LMFT)
  • Minimum of two years of supervisory experience in family social services provisioning and/or children’s mental health.
  • 5 years direct client services working with children, youth, young adults, or families with complex mental health related diagnosis.
  • Knowledge of and direct client service experience with family systems theory and application; social ecological theory and application; behavioral therapies theory and application; cognitive-behavioral therapy theory and application; pragmatic family therapies theory and application; child development research and its application in treatment; social skills assessment and intervention
